About .camp domains

A .camp domain is a generic top-level domain (gTLD) that is open to anyone to register. It was launched in 2016 and is intended for use by any business or organization that can be described as a camp. This includes summer camps, sports camps, Christian camps, corporate training camps, and even vacation destinations.

If you are considering registering a .camp domain, there are a few things you should keep in mind:

  • .camp domain names must be at least 1 and no more than 63 characters long.
  • They must begin and end with a letter or number.
  • They can only contain letters (a-z, A-Z), numbers (0-9), and hyphens (-).
  • They cannot begin or end with a hyphen.
  • They cannot contain a hyphen in the third and fourth positions.
  • They cannot include a space.

What is .camp domain used for?

The “.camp” domain is a generic top-level domain (gTLD) used for websites and online entities related to the theme of “camp.” This domain extension can be employed by a variety of organizations and individuals for different purposes related to the concept of “camp.” Here are some common uses of the “.camp” domain:

  1. Summer Camps: Many websites for summer camps for children and teenagers use the “.camp” domain. These websites provide information about camp programs, registration details, activities, and more.
  2. Camping and Outdoor Activities: Websites dedicated to camping, hiking, backpacking, and other outdoor recreational activities may use “.camp” to share tips, gear reviews, trip reports, and other related information.
  3. Campgrounds and Resorts: Campgrounds, RV parks, and outdoor resorts often use “.camp” to showcase their facilities, amenities, and provide online reservation systems for campers.
  4. Technology or Coding Bootcamps: Coding bootcamps or technology-related training programs may use “.camp” to indicate their educational focus and attract students interested in learning tech skills.
  5. Arts and Creativity Camps: Camps that specialize in arts and crafts, music, dance, theater, or other creative pursuits may use “.camp” to promote their programs and activities.
  6. Sports Camps: Websites for sports camps offering training and development in various sports disciplines can use “.camp” to reflect their offerings and attract athletes.
  7. Military or Survival Training: Organizations offering survival training, military-themed activities, or outdoor survival courses might use “.camp” to convey their expertise in these areas.
  8. Fitness and Wellness Camps: Health and wellness camps, yoga retreats, fitness-focused programs, and similar ventures can also use “.camp” to represent their wellness-oriented services.

The “.camp” domain provides a specific and relevant online identity for entities involved in camp-related activities. It helps users quickly understand the nature of the website and can be a valuable branding tool for businesses and organizations in these niches.
